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to site personnel and visitors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and/or emergency response activities at a government location.
  • Carry and maintain issued firearm and related equipment in accordance with Allied Universal policies, post orders, and applicable laws and/or licensing requirements.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including requesting support from on-site staff and/or public law enforcement as needed.
  • Conduct regular and random armed patrols of buildings, grounds, and perimeter areas, checking doors, gates, lighting, and other conditions that may help to deter unauthorized activity.
  • Monitor access points and controlled areas, verify identification and/or authorization, document security-related activity in written and/or electronic logs, and report unusual conditions through the chain of command.
